Hello,

I have a Request Approval action for a user account provisioning workflow. It's a very complex workflow with many branches of actions. I would like to set the approval to auto-approve after a couple days if no one has actually responded. I think I saw where you could do this with an Assign Task action. I either need to be able to:

A) Add an auto-approval after a couple days to the Request Approval action if possible.

OR

B) Easily move all of the branched workflow actions currently setup underneath the Request Approval action underneath the Assign Task action so I can setup some kind of auto-approve.

Does anyone have any recommendations?

Hi

not in front of my designer at the moment to check but I think with request approval task doesn't easily allow for this. Can you swap it for an assign flexi task action which has this readily available to you on the escalate task?

If you drag the new action into your workflow, and configure it, you can then move the original subsequent actions into the proper branches. I would recommend disabling the original Task action rather than deleting it just in case it does not work out.

The main focus will be configuring the new Flexi Task Action. The rest is simply drag and drop (or copy/paste).

Another option to consider is to drop sections into an Action set. This allows you to grab the action set and move it around and it keeps everything that you put into the action set together. You can also "minimize" the action set to reduce how "large" the workflow is.

I do this with Flexi Tasks and loops to consolidate space and quickly copy/paste entire sections of logic.
